I'm trying to repair a very stubborn TDS-520 fails on testing the proc and acquisition boards. Major capacitor leakage inside the unit. After a thorough clean and recap the unit this fails on both boards. Further research showed a track under a resistor that was broken. I repaired the broken track but it still isn't working correctly.

I found out there's a debug port: J40 (board edge connector). Information in the internet about this debug port is fragmented and far from complete. I'm trying to get this sorted out to a complete solution.

speaks about connecting an Option 13 (serial/parallel comm board) to this debug port. Separate option 13 boards are hard to find and otherwise quite expensive. It basically is nothing more than a pcb with a MC68681 Dual UART, some logic and 2 d-sub connectors.

Is there any schematic around of the Option 13 board? Or any other circuit that interfaces between the scope and the serial port of a pc?

Apologies for the gravedig, but does anyone have this pinout for the J40 Debug port to Option 13 adapter? Seems the Tek website links no longer work...

I'm currently designing a USB debug adapter and want to check the pinouts to make sure mine are correct.

and here's also a copy of the important bit:
****
Console port - Option 13 Board - (Signal Name)
A10 - 1 - (D24)
B10 - 3 - (D25)
A9 - 5 - (D26)
B9 - 7 - (D27)
B8 - 2 - (D28)
A7 - 4 - (D29)
B7 - 6 - (D30)
A6 - 8 - (D31)

B1 - 21 - (A1)
A1 - 23 - (A2)
B2 - 25 - (A3)
A2 - 22 - (A4)
+5V (B6) - 24 - (A5)
GND (A3/A8) - 26 - (A6)

B5 - 12 - (INT#)
B4 - 15 - (IOCS#)
A5 - 16 - (SYSRESET#)
A4 - 17 - (RNW)

A3, A8 - 9, 13, 19 - (GND)
B6 - 10, 20 - (+5V)

B3 - not connected

not connected - 11 - (DS#)
not connected - 14 - (DSACK0#)
not connected - 18 - (AS#)

Notes:
- As displayed in the "TDS520B Mod CM" service manual, On the console port "B" is the top side of the processor board.
- Signals A5 (Pin 24) and A6 (Pin 26) need to be set to +5V and Gnd to make sure the serial port of the option 13 board is selected.
- The 3 ground pins (9, 13, 19) should be connected on the option 13 board, so normally you only need to connect one of these to the console port connector.
Nevertheless I connected them all.
- The 2 +5V pins (10, 20) should be connected on the option 13 board, so normally you only need to connect one of these to the console port connector.
